WebAug 1, 2002 · Upstream from the dam, geomorphic processes should follow a coherent sequence (figure 1). First, the channel will incise through the sediment fill. Bank failures will occur if the channel depth increases above a critical value that depends on the strength of the soil and the detailed geometry of the stream. WebJun 9, 2024 · Suspended sediment, the kind of sediment that is moved in the water itself, is measured by collecting bottles of water and sending them to a lab to determine the concentration. Because the amount of sediment a river can transport changes over time, hydrologists take measurements and samples as streamflow goes up and down during a …
